Description
This fall recipe combines roasted chicken with seasonal vegetables like sweet potatoes, Brussels sprouts, and apples for a comforting dinner.
Ingredients
Scale
- 4 chicken thighs, bone-in and skin-on
- 2 cups sweet potatoes, cubed
- 2 cups Brussels sprouts, halved
- 1 apple, sliced
- 3 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 teaspoon dried thyme
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h thyme for garnish
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
- In a large bowl, combine sweet potatoes, Brussels sprouts, and apple slices. Drizzle with olive oil, and season with thyme, garlic powder, salt, and pepper. Toss to coat.
- Arrange the vegetable mixture on a large baking sheet.
- Season the chicken thighs with salt and pepper, and place them on top of the vegetables.
- Roast in the preheated oven for 35-40 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and the vegetables are tender.
- Garnish with fresh thyme before serving.
